Ayverie is a girl's name of American origin. An extended, more ornate version of Ayveri with a sophisticated '-erie' ending, Ayverie evokes both Avery and ethereal names like Rory or Amerie. The name has a whimsical, almost fantasy-like quality while remaining grounded in contemporary naming patterns. It feels both inventive and elegant.
Reflects the trend toward extended, elaborate variations of popular name patterns.
